Not known Factual Statements About security in software development



security in software development Secrets



Complex. Builders require an array of technological competencies, which may consist of penetration tests and ethical hacking and also basic programming languages, for instance C or Java.

Even if companies conform to a certain method design, there is not any warranty which the software they Make is free of unintentional security vulnerabilities or intentional malicious code. Even so, there might be a far better probability of developing secure software when a corporation follows stable software engineering methods using an emphasis on good style and design, good quality methods like inspections and reviews, usage of comprehensive tests procedures, correct use of applications, threat management, venture management, and other people administration.

In a few instances the business would require the usage of unsupported software, such as Home windows XP. If that’s the case, be sure to leverage compensating controls to Restrict the risk exposure into the organization.

Notes: Deploying an online software firewall was consolidated from A few sections into just one portion with version 7. The upper-stage check out removes the controls for particular vulnerabilities, opting alternatively for the wide stroke of safeguarding versus attacks using a Software.

One method to make this happen devoid of remaining confrontational will be to enforce rigor in creating user tales and estimating them to make sure that complexities get uncovered ahead of coding commences.

We're starting to see device-Finding out currently being crafted into automated tests instruments and when it truly is early times, it'll create a significant difference Later on.

Execute the take a look at options through the verification phase. This will likely verify if the products performs as anticipated in runtime eventualities. Penetration tests evaluate how the solution handles numerous abuse conditions, like:

California also provides the best yearly indicate wages to devices software developers, when Washington features leading salaries for application software development specialists.

  Permission is necessary for any other use.  Requests for permission need to be directed to your Software Engineering Institute at [email protected].

Security Threat Identification and Management Activities. There's broad consensus within the Local community that identifying and running security pitfalls is one of the most important activities in the safe SDLC and actually is the driving force for subsequent activities.

The gtag.js tagging library works by using HTTP Cookies to "recall" the person's preceding interactions Together with the Websites.

The code evaluate stage must ensure the software security in advance of it enters the output phase, in which repairing vulnerabilities will Price a bundle.

To create a robust and lasting change in habits, teaching involves material certain to the business’s record. When contributors can see themselves in a problem, they’re a lot more more likely to know how the fabric is suitable for their get the job done as well as when and how to use whatever they’ve discovered. One way to do This check here is certainly to employ noteworthy attacks on the organization’s software as examples inside the coaching curriculum. The two prosperous and unsuccessful attacks will make good teachable times.

To enable the maintainers to know how the implementation satisfies the necessities. A document targeted at maintainers is far shorter, more affordable to make and even more handy than a conventional structure document.



Helping The others Realize The Advantages Of security in software development


Exceptional training course with great deal of sources to master principles. Sites seriously handy to update understanding. Easy policies will stay away from significant fines by govt and safeguard brand reputations

Several months on with the SolarWinds attack, a whole new report from Osterman Exploration implies that organizations have nevertheless to address the underlying men and women-linked security concerns that can result in these kinds of software offer chain compromises. Imperfect Individuals, Susceptible Apps outlines the human components contributing to cyber risk within the software development lifecycle (SDLC) depending on responses from 260 persons in application development and security roles through the US and United kingdom.

businesses use to make an application from inception right up until decommission. Development teams use various designs such as

It is just a Device for organizing and controlling by management and can be read more regarded a roadmap of the venture where all big events have by now been recognized, in conjunction with their corresponding components.

Security demands happen to be recognized for the software and facts remaining made and/or maintained.

Software testing can be a approach used to find bugs in software by executing an software or simply a program. It also aims to verify the software works as predicted and fulfills the technical and enterprise needs, as prepared in the look and development phase.

Test OWASP’s security code overview manual to comprehend the mechanics of reviewing code for specified vulnerabilities, and get the steering on how to structure and execute the trouble.

Our provider portfolio addresses an entire software development existence cycle and satisfies diversified business desires.

“The difficult issue about security schooling for developers could it be must be suitable information, at the right time, website to promote innovation.”

Assessments, evaluations, appraisals – All 3 of these phrases indicate comparison of the method staying practiced to a reference course of action design or normal. Assessments, evaluations, and appraisals are made use of to grasp process capability so that you can boost procedures.

By Michael Hill United kingdom Editor, CSO

Possessing your software techniques analyzed for bugs, flaws and vulnerabilities routinely can help you save dollars In the end and safeguard you from information breaches that undermine your model’s integrity and damage your reputation. 

The legacy, classroom-based techniques don't engage developers or impart the expertise required to match the quickly-paced menace landscape click here and dynamic know-how fundamentals on the SDLC.

Other frequent themes consist of security metrics and In general defect reduction as characteristics of the protected SDLC system.

Leave a Reply

Your email address will not be published. Required fields are marked *